ASP(Active Server Pages)是一种用于创建动态网页的技术,它允许服务器在响应客户端请求时生成HTML内容。在ASP中,会话管理是保持用户登录状态的关键技术之一。
当用户访问网站时,服务器通常会为每个用户创建一个唯一的会话ID。这个ID被存储在Cookie或URL参数中,以便在后续请求中识别用户。通过这种方式,服务器可以跟踪用户的活动并维持其登录状态。
为了安全起见,会话ID不应长时间有效。设置合理的超时时间可以防止未授权的访问。例如,如果用户在一定时间内没有进行任何操作,系统应自动结束会话,要求重新登录。
AI绘图结果,仅供参考
在ASP中,可以使用Session对象来存储与当前用户相关的数据。这些数据仅在该用户的会话期间有效,一旦会话结束,数据将被清除。合理利用Session对象可以提升用户体验,同时减少服务器资源的浪费。
除了使用内置的Session对象,还可以结合数据库来实现更复杂的会话管理。例如,将用户登录信息存储在数据库中,并在每次请求时验证会话的有效性。这种方法适用于需要更高安全性的应用场景。